Clovis has a cost index of 120 vs 97 for Odessa. Clovis is 23 points more expensive overall. Monthly rent goes from $1,612 to $2,311 (+43%).
If you earn the Odessa median of $73,030, you would need approximately $90,346/year in Clovis to maintain equivalent purchasing power, based on the cost index difference of 23 points (24%).
Median rent in Odessa is $1,612/month. In Clovis it is $2,311/month — a difference of +$699 per month, or $8,388 per year.
Moving to Clovis looks like a financial upgrade — better income-to-cost ratio. The salary equivalent to maintain your current lifestyle is $90,346/year in Clovis. The median income there is $100,360.
Estimated monthly essentials total $3,463 in Odessa vs $4,577 in Clovis — a difference of +$1,114/month (+$13,368/year).
The median home price in Clovis is $513,830 vs $248,410 in Odessa. With 20% down and a 6.5% rate, the estimated monthly mortgage payment is $2,598 in Clovis vs $1,256 in Odessa.
